Author Information

Koreen advocates new ways of using technology for organizational learning, with an emphasis on performance improvement and behavioral change. She received her MS in Curriculum and Instruction from Penn State University. She helped start Freire Charter School in 1999, and founded Tandem Learning in 2008 to demonstrate the untapped potential of immersive learning design. Koreen has taught graduate courses at Harrisburg University, writes the blog Learning in Tandem, and is currently working in product management at lynda.com. Koreen lives in Carpinteria, California.
